Transaction 140491821c26339fff4a5a946f497f0c7fbf761a070b4f24c1fa35551bc103ef
2 Input
2 Outputs
- 140491821c26339fff4a5a946f497f0c7fbf761a070b4f24c1fa35551bc103ef:0
- 140491821c26339fff4a5a946f497f0c7fbf761a070b4f24c1fa35551bc103ef:1
value 7525
address 137Ce4w1zs35Jo4W7RrUDgeoHqcKTSAvfp
value 2699000
address 1Fy3tRFqiZuGiGMEzhuthhVesR61TBgLhK